  • Patent number: 5616696
    Abstract: A group of compounds comprising the reaction product of a hydroxy naphthylamine sulfonic acid with a diazotized compound comprising, an aromatic azo substituted Cleves Acid such that the diazotized compound is coupled with the hydroxy naphthylamine sulfonic acid ortho to the amine group. More particularly the compounds of the invention comprise a compound having the formula: ##STR1## wherein R.sub.1 is an aromatic azo radical, R.sub.2 is hydrogen or an aromatic azo group and R.sub.3 is amino, substituted amino or an aromatic azo group. The invention further includes inks made from such compositions and methods for using such inks in ink jet printers.

  • Patent number: 4933156
    Abstract: The presence and location of amyloid deposits in an organ or body area of a patient is effected by intravenous administration of novel radioactive iodine-labeled amyloid binding compounds and preferably .sup.123 I-labeled compounds to the patient and sensing radiation emitted from the organ or body area. Novel non-radioactive iodine substituted amyloid binding compounds and amyloid binding compounds which are readily iodinated are further aspects of the invention.
